Letter "N n"
TOPIC: Letter "Nn"
OBJECTIVES:
1. Learn and practise mouth formation for different sounds of the alphabet ("n")
2. Blend phonemes to form words
3. Substitute consonant sounds in words with similar rhymes to derive new words
4. Learn and use basic sight words
CONTENT :
Letter "Nn" is a letter of the alphabet. It is a consonant.
ENGAGE:
Students will review letter sounds dealt with so far. /s/, /a/, /t/, /i/, /p/
Students will orally complete the matching game below orally.
They will be asked to stress the initial sound heard as the words are called.
Identify the letter that makes the sound. "n"
Pay attention to mouth formation as the letter sound is stressed.
EXPLORE:
Watch video clip to lean more about letter "n", and learn words with initial and final sound.
Pronounce the new words from the clip, by blending phonemes.
Continue to blend phenemes to read the words below.
nap, nip, pan, pin, tin, ant, pant, snip, snap, span, spin
Identify the location of the "n" sound.
Form/write the letter "n" in their books accurately.
EXPLAIN:
Supply words with initial and ending "n" sound.
Write both upper and lower case "Nn" in their books.
ELABORATE:
Substitute consonants to form new words, then use blend phonemes to help pronounce new words.
eg. net/pet, pen/hen, pin/sin
Use some of the new words formed to complete sentences accurately.
Choose the correct sight words highlighted for the day to help in completion.
SIGHT WORDS: in, not, no, now, none, into, an, any, again, and, can, then
Complete the sentences below.
1. All the chickens are (in, into) the (pin, pen).
2. There is (no, not) (pen, sin) in my bag.
